References

Recent publications from the group include:

  • Bonfield, James K. and Staden, Rodger. ZTR: a new format for DNA sequence trace data. Bioinformatics 18, 3-10, (2002).

  • Bonfield, James, K., Beal, Kathryn F., Betts, Matthew J. and Staden, Rodger. Trev: a DNA trace editor and viewer. Bioinformatics 18, 194-195, (2002)

  • Rodger Staden, David P. Judge and James K. Bonfield SEQUENCE ASSEMBLY AND FINISHING METHODS Bioinformatics. A Practical Guide to the Analysis of Genes and Proteins. Second Edition Eds. Andreas D. Baxevanis and B. F. Francis Ouellette. John Wiley & Sons, New York, NY, USA.

  • The C. elegans Sequencing Consortium. Genome Sequence of the Nematode C. elegans: A Platform for Investigating Biology. Science 282, 2012-2018 (1998)

  • Rodger Staden, Kathryn F. Beal and James K. Bonfield The Staden Package, 1998. Computer Methods in Molecular Biology, pages 115-130, vol. 132: Bioinformatics Methods and Protocols Eds Stephen Misener and Steve A. Krawetz. The Humana Press Inc., Totowa, NJ 07512

  • Bonfield, J.K., Rada, C. and Staden, R. Automated detection of point mutations using flourescent sequence trace subtraction. Nucleic Acids Res. 26, 3404-3409 (1998)

  • Cesar Milstein, Michael S. Neuberger and Rodger Staden. Both DNA strands of antibody genes are hypermutation targets. Proc. Natl. Acad. Sci. USA, 95, 8791-8794 (1998)

  • Flint, J., Sims, M., Clark, K., Staden, R. and Thomas, K. An Oligo-Screening Strategy to Fill Gaps Found During Shotgun Sequencing Projects. DNA Sequence 8, 241-245 (1998)

  • Staden, R. The Staden Sequence Analysis Package. Molecular Biotechnology 5, 233-241 (1996)

  • Bonfield, J.K. and Staden, R. Experiment files and their application during large-scale sequencing projects. DNA Sequence 6, 109-117 (1996)

  • Staden, R. Indexing and using sequence databases. Methods in Enzymology 266, 105-114 (1996)

  • Bonfield, J.K., Smith, K.F. and Staden, R. A new DNA sequence assembly program. Nucleic Acids Res. 23, 4992-4999 (1995)

  • Bonfield, J.K. and Staden, R. The application of numerical estimates of base calling accuracy to DNA sequencing projects. Nucleic Acids Res. 23, 1406-1410 (1995)

  • Dear, S. and Staden, R. A standard file format for data from DNA sequencing instruments. DNA Sequence 3, 107-110 (1992)

  • Staden, R. and Dear, S. Indexing the sequence libraries: Software providing a common indexing system for all the standard sequence libraries. DNA Sequence 3, 99-105 (1992).

  • Dear, S. and Staden, R. A sequence assembly and editing program for efficient management of large projects. Nucleic Acid Res. 19, 3907-3911 (1991).

  • Staden, R. Screening protein and nucleic acid sequences against libraries of patterns. DNA Sequence 1, 369-374 (1991).

  • Staden, R. Searching for patterns in protein and nucleic acid sequences. Methods in Enzymology 183, 193-211. (1990).

  • Staden, R. Finding protein coding regions in genomic sequences. Methods in Enzymology 183, 163-180. (1990).

    Not so recent publications from the group include:

  • Staden, R. Methods for discovering novel motifs in nucleic acid sequences. CABIOS 5, 293-298 (1989)

  • Staden R, Methods for calculating the probabilities of finding patterns in sequences. CABIOS 5 89-96 (1989)

  • Staden R, Methods to define and locate patterns of motifs in sequences. CABIOS 4, 53-60 (1988)

  • Staden, R. Graphic methods to determine the function of nucleic acid sequences. Nucleic Acid Res. 12, 521-538 (1984)

  • Staden, R. Computer methods to locate signals in nucleic acid sequences. Nucleic Acid Res. 12, 505-519 (1984)

  • Staden, R. A computer program to enter DNA gel reading data into a computer. Nucleic Acid Res. 12, 499-503 (1984)

  • Staden, R. Measurements of the effects that coding for a protein has on a DNA sequence and their use for finding genes. Nucleic Acid Res. 12, 551-567 (1984)

  • Staden, R. and McLachlan, A.D. Codon preference and its use in identifying protein coding regions in long DNA sequences. Nucleic Acid Res. 10 141-156 (1982)

  • Staden, R. Automation of the computer handling of gel reading data produced by the shotgun method of DNA sequencing. Nucleic Acid Res. 10, 4731-4751 (1982)

  • Staden, R. An interactive graphics program for comparing and aligning nucleic acid and amino acid sequences. Nucleic Acid Res. 10, 2951-2961 (1982)

  • Staden, R. A new computer method for the storage and manipulation of DNA gel reading data. Nucleic Acid Res. 8, 3673-3694 (1980)

  • Staden, R. A computer program to search for tRNA genes. Nucleic Acid Res. 8, 817-825 (1980)
